Director of Asset Management - Multifamily

University Partners is a nationally recognized real estate investment and management firm focused on delivering value across multifamily communities. They are seeking an experienced and strategic Director of Asset Management to support the VP of Asset Management and drive performance for a 15,000-unit national multifamily portfolio.

Real Estate

Responsibilities

Serve as a key member of the asset management team with direct impact on portfolio performance
Analyze market performance and multifamily operations to identify opportunities and underperformance
Partner with marketing, revenue management, accounting, capital, and operations to formulate and execute strategies that maximize portfolio value
Review weekly/monthly reporting and analytical tools to identify trends, benchmark performance, and recommend solutions
Apply a value-oriented approach to each asset, including revenue generation strategies, capital allocation, and operational efficiencies
Build and maintain strong relationships with operating partners; resolve issues and conflicts internally and externally
Conduct property site visits to assess physical condition, diagnose performance challenges, and recommend improvements
Collaborate with the Capital Expenditures team to assess property-level needs and develop both short- and long-term capital plans
Monitor market trends for opportunities such as renovations, expansions, or repositioning projects
Play an active role in developing annual operating and capital budgets, as well as reforecasting as needed
Support acquisition underwriting and due diligence by providing leasing assumptions and market intelligence
Evaluate and implement new products and services aimed at driving revenue, reducing costs, or improving efficiency
Mentor and develop junior analysts on the team
Oversee monthly and annual cashflow projections between Operations and Accounting
Develop annual capital plans, monitor progress, and ensure execution by operators
Track litigation and risk issues for each asset, ensuring timely resolution
Maintain updated market analyses in collaboration with operations and revenue management to achieve occupancy and revenue goals
Coordinate stakeholders during new acquisition transitions
Lead rollout of revenue-generating initiatives, monitor results, and report on performance

Qualification

Asset managementFinancial analysisReal estate principlesMarket analysisBudgetingInterpersonal skillsLeadershipCommunication skills

Required

Bachelor's degree in Business, Finance, Real Estate, or related field
7+ years of experience in acquisition or asset management for large-scale portfolios (5,000–7,000+ units) with mixed-use retail across major MSAs. Minimum 4 years in multifamily asset management
Strong working knowledge of real estate principles, including operations, financial analysis, budgeting, reporting, ROI analysis, cash management, and accounting
Ability to interpret market trends, competitive surveys, and third-party reports
Familiarity with investment due diligence and providing market-based leasing assumptions
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to explain complex issues clearly
Demonstrated leadership ability, with experience mentoring and developing team members
Proven ability to thrive in a fast-paced, dynamic environment with evolving priorities
Based in Dallas, with ability to travel 20–25%
Ideal candidate brings a balanced background in both finance and operations (approximately 75% finance / 25% operations or 50/50)
